HCMC: More than 17,000 women who give birth to 2 children before the age of 35 receive 3-5 million VND

(Dan Tri) - On the morning of September 25, Ho Chi Minh City awarded 3 million VND in support to a number of women who gave birth to 2 children before the age of 35. This is one of a series of policies to deal with the declining birth rate in Ho Chi Minh City.

It is necessary to carry out many synchronous solutions to promote birth.

Sharing with Dan Tri on the sidelines of the ceremony, Mr. Pham Chanh Trung, Head of the Ho Chi Minh City Population Department, said that supporting women to give birth to two children before the age of 35 is one of many policies issued by the Ho Chi Minh City government to address the low birth rate in recent times.

Specifically, in 2024, the People's Council of Ho Chi Minh City issued Resolution No. 40/2024/ND-HDND, deciding to support 3 million VND for women who give birth to two children before the age of 35. This Resolution applies from December 21, 2024 to August 31, 2025.

"According to preliminary statistics, about 9,100 women in the old Ho Chi Minh City area are eligible to receive this support. Wards in the area have received applications and made payments according to regulations," Mr. Trung shared.

After merging with Binh Duong and Ba Ria - Vung Tau , the city government continued to issue Resolution No. 32/2025/NQ-HDND, deciding to support 5 million VND for women who give birth to two children before the age of 35. This resolution takes effect from September 1.

"According to our quick statistics, the city currently has about 8,100 women receiving this support," said Mr. Trung.

According to the Head of the Ho Chi Minh City Department of Population, the support levels of 3-5 million VND are a gift to encourage couples to have two children before the age of 35, solving the city's low birth rate.

In addition, in April, the Ho Chi Minh City People's Committee issued a decision on the Project for comprehensive health care and increasing the total fertility rate for the period 2025-2030.

This project includes many solutions such as supporting the cost of pre-marital health check-ups, vaccinations for women before pregnancy and childbirth, periodic health check-ups for students at all levels, and completely exempting tuition fees for all levels...

These comprehensive solutions, combined with inter-sectoral coordination, will help change people's thinking about marriage, pregnancy and childbirth, contributing to solving the low birth rate in Ho Chi Minh City.

Sharing more, Mr. Trung said that after the merger, Ho Chi Minh City became a megacity with 168 wards and communes with a population of about 14 million people. The city's population picture stands out with two main characteristics: low birth rate and aging population.

After the merger, the total fertility rate of Ho Chi Minh City is 1.43 children per woman of childbearing age, ranking among the 13 provinces and cities with the lowest fertility rates in Vietnam. Although still in the golden population structure period, with the proportion of working-age population accounting for about 70-71%, the city can no longer maintain its ideal population status.

In addition, Ho Chi Minh City is also facing a rapid aging rate with more than 1.4 million elderly people, the largest in the country. The average life expectancy of the city's residents is 76.2 years old, higher than the national average (74.7 years old).

These characteristics pose great challenges for population work, as prolonged low fertility and population aging will affect the labor structure and future socio -economic development.
